How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Grays River?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Grays River Studio Apartments | $1,454 | $900 | $2,375 |
| Grays River 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,681 | $1,050 | $2,452 |
| Grays River 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,956 | $1,200 | $3,204 |
| Grays River 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,147 | $1,450 | $3,035 |
| Grays River 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,799 | $2,245 | $3,299 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Grays River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Grays River with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Grays River is at Hemlock Court listed at $1,200.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Grays River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Grays River is $1,956.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Grays River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Grays River is a 1,137 square feet unit starting from $2,345 at Woodbury Crossing Apartments and Townhomes.
What is the average size for Grays River 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Grays River is currently 979 sq ft.
